Why Emotional Intelligence Matters More Than Ever

Emotional intelligence (EQ) is your capacity to comprehend and control emotions, including workplace conflict resolution, stress management, parenting, and fostering closer bonds with others.

Unlike IQ, which tends to remain relatively fixed, emotional intelligence can grow with awareness and effort. This makes EQ testing extremely empowering and relevant, particularly for those who want to improve their relationships with others or grow personally.

Studies have linked high EQ with [1]:

  • Stronger interpersonal relationships
  • Better leadership outcomes
  • Reduced anxiety and burnout
  • Increased resilience in the face of stress

In short, emotional intelligence affects how you feel, communicate, and connect. And taking a test is the best way to find out what you’re good at and where you might want to improve.

What to Look for in an Emotional Intelligence Test

Not every test of emotional intelligence is useful or even reliable. Some are made more for amusement than knowledge, while others overburden users with generic or scholarly terms.

There are a few important things to look for if you want a test that genuinely promotes growth:

  • Clarity and Simplicity: An effective EQ test should be easy to understand. A psychology degree shouldn’t be required to comprehend the questions or analyze the findings.
  • Research-Based Framework: Seek out assessments based on generally recognized EQ models, like the Mayer-Salovey or Daniel Goleman frameworks. These emphasize empathy, social skills, emotional awareness, and regulation.
  • Results That Are Insightful and Actionable: The best tests provide more than just a score; they provide insight. What is the meaning of your score? What could be the cause? What’s one thing you could try differently?
  • Tone and Design That Feels Supportive: The test’s wording is crucial, particularly if you’ve experienced trauma or struggle with emotional overload. It should feel respectful rather than critical or too clinical.

The Gut-Brain Connection: What Every Parent Should Know

Science has long known that the brain influences the gut. But what’s now becoming clear is that the gut influences the brain, particularly through the microbiome, the vast community of microbes living in our digestive systems.

These microbes don’t just help break down food; they produce neurotransmitters like serotonin and dopamine, which affect mood, motivation, and focus. According to the U.S. National Institutes of Health, disruptions in gut flora have been linked to attention disorders, anxiety, and even sleep challenges in children.

Kids are especially sensitive to gut imbalance due to irregular mealtimes, processed foods, and anxiety around food or school routines. Symptoms like bloating, gas, or fatigue after meals may go unspoken but can significantly reduce a child’s ability to focus on lessons or homework.

Why Routine Matters More Than Perfect Nutrition

Parents often feel pressure to prepare the “perfect lunchbox” or follow idealistic diets seen online. But according to many pediatric and IBS dietitian experts, the structure around meals may be just as important as the food itself.

Here’s why food routines are critical for child concentration:

  • Predictability supports digestion. The body produces enzymes more efficiently when meals occur at consistent times.
  • Mindful meals reduce stress. Children who eat calmly and slowly are less likely to experience bloating, discomfort, or sugar crashes.
  • Balanced rhythms regulate energy. Skipping breakfast or delaying snacks often leads to crashes mid-morning or afternoon.

The takeaway? Focus less on perfection, and more on rhythm. Even a modest breakfast eaten with attention and calm can lay the groundwork for better classroom focus.

Key Food Habits That Support Learning

Little girl laying on her back surrounded by colorful healthy food.

You don’t need to reinvent your pantry to help your child stay focused. Instead, consider how these research-backed strategies can fit into your existing family routines:

1. Start the Day with Protein and Fiber

Protein helps sustain attention, while fiber slows glucose release, avoiding the classic sugar crash. Think eggs with toast, nut butter on whole grain bread, or yogurt with berries and chia.

2. Incorporate Fermented Foods

Yogurt, kefir, sauerkraut, or miso introduce beneficial bacteria that support gut health. These can be small sides or integrated into dips and spreads.

3. Schedule Breaks with Snacks

Plan structured snacks mid-morning and mid-afternoon. Keep them light and purposeful, like hummus and carrots, apple slices with cheese, or a homemade trail mix.

4. Hydration Is Focus Fuel

Mild dehydration can mimic ADHD-like symptoms. Encourage frequent sips of water, especially between meals and during study breaks.

5. Limit High-Sugar “Focus Killers”

Refined sugar creates rapid spikes and crashes in blood sugar, which can tank focus and mood. Save treats for after school or on weekends.

Encouraging Mindful Eating in a Fast-Paced World

Mindful eating isn’t about long, meditative meals. It’s about teaching kids to slow down, notice how they feel, and listen to their bodies. These simple practices improve digestion, emotional self-regulation, and attention span.

Tips to introduce mindful eating without resistance:

  • Ask one “feeling” question at mealtime: “Is your tummy happy?”
  • Encourage children to chew slowly and put down utensils between bites
  • Model phone-free meals, even short ones
  • Let children serve their own portions when possible to promote autonomy
  • Use post-meal check-ins: “Did that food give you good energy?”

These low-pressure practices help children associate meals with awareness, not just compliance. Over time, this builds a more confident, intuitive relationship with food.

When to Seek Additional Support

Sometimes, food and environment changes aren’t enough. If your child consistently experiences:

  • Brain fog after meals
  • Abdominal pain or irregular bowel movements
  • Fatigue that worsens after eating
  • Mood swings linked to food intake

…it may be time to speak with a pediatrician or certified IBS dietitian. A trained professional can identify food sensitivities, gut imbalances, or inflammatory triggers that impact your child’s cognitive and emotional state. Intervention doesn’t need to be dramatic. Often, gentle dietary shifts and probiotic support or FODMAP supplements, paired with structured mealtimes, can yield transformative improvements in both digestion and school performance.

Understanding the Digital Landscape

Children today are digital natives. They’re growing up in a world where devices are part of everyday life. While this brings certain advantages, such as access to educational resources and social connections, it also introduces risks including reduced physical activity, delayed social development, and sleep disruption. The challenge for modern parents isn’t removing technology but managing it thoughtfully and effectively.

This means being mindful not only of how much screen time children are getting but also of what type of content they’re consuming, when they’re using screens, and how it fits into the rest of their daily routine. A blanket ban rarely works in the long term. Instead, informed, balanced choices create an environment where kids thrive both on and off screen.

Quality Over Quantity

Not all screen time is created equal. Watching cartoons for hours is very different from engaging with an educational app or joining a virtual class. Parents should aim to prioritize quality content that supports their child’s development, such as programs that encourage creativity, critical thinking, or collaboration.

Co-viewing and co-playing can also enhance the value of screen time. When parents watch, play, or talk about digital content with their children, it becomes a shared experience rather than a solitary one. This not only builds trust and communication but also helps children develop a healthier relationship with technology.

Creating Structure and Boundaries

One of the most effective ways to encourage safe screen habits is to set consistent boundaries. This could mean establishing “screen-free” zones such as bedrooms or family meal areas, or having daily time limits that align with age-appropriate guidelines. Clear rules around device use, especially before bedtime, help ensure that screens don’t interfere with sleep, play, or other essential activities.

Involving children in the process of setting these rules can lead to better outcomes. When kids understand why certain boundaries are in place, they’re more likely to respect them and internalize good habits that last beyond childhood.

The Role of Parental Modeling

Children often mirror the behavior of adults, and screen use is no exception. If kids see parents constantly scrolling, checking emails during dinner, or reaching for their phones in every spare moment, they’ll likely do the same. Modeling balanced, mindful screen use sets a strong example and reinforces the idea that devices should serve a purpose, not dominate every free moment.

This also means making time for meaningful offline experiences. Reading, playing outside, doing crafts, or simply having conversations without screens in the background all contribute to a more balanced lifestyle.

When to Step In

Despite the best intentions, screen time can sometimes become excessive or problematic. Warning signs include irritability when devices are taken away, a drop in academic performance, social withdrawal, or difficulty sleeping. In such cases, parents should feel empowered to reassess the family’s digital habits and make necessary changes.

The Danger of Cognitive Offloading from AI Use by Children

Curious young girl using a laptop.

In the space of a single school generation, generative AI assistants have leapt from laboratory curiosities to everyday parts of many children’s lives. A teenager can now ask for an algebra proof, a Shakespearean sonnet, or a colour-coded study plan and receive a response in moments.

The sensation feels magical, yet it rests on cognitive offloading: the instinct to shift memory, reasoning, or creativity onto an external aid so the brain can relax. Offloading is hardly new: people have long scribbled shopping lists, saved phone numbers in their contacts, and trusted calculators to check sums.

What alarms many educators today is that modern AI doesn’t merely store information: it manufactures answers. And the more effortlessly it does so, the easier it becomes for growing minds to surrender the mental muscles that make learning meaningful.

When AI Becomes a Cognitive Crutch

A ‘cognitive prosthesis’ that thinks for us

Writing captures thought and search engines retrieve facts, but neither turns a raw prompt into a polished argument. Generative AI does exactly that, interpreting a question, selecting data, and drafting a coherent response. Because it carries out part of the thinking process, researchers describe it as a cognitive prosthesis.

A 2025 longitudinal study followed university students for two semesters and found that heavy users of AI scored markedly lower on critical-thinking assessments, with cognitive offloading being a major cause.

The lure of instant solutions

Fast, fluent answers feel rewarding, and children quickly learn that chatbots never shrug or say ‘come back later.’ But this over-reliance on quick solutions not only impacts a person’s ability to actually learn about the topic of their essays, but it can also have further impacts on their capabilities. Experiments by MIT have shown that people who regularly drafted essays with ChatGPT ‘consistently underperformed at neural, linguistic, and behavioral levels’.

Frictionless design leads to misplaced trust

AI Developers compete on immediacy with autocomplete prompts, one-click copy buttons, and friendly avatars that minimize friction. That seamlessness invites passive acceptance, which has been claimed to erode ‘the mental stamina required for complex reasoning,’ particularly in brains still laying down executive-function pathways (i.e. children).

A historic habit that’s now super-charged

Humans have always offloaded mental labor: the abacus shifted arithmetic onto beads, printing pressed knowledge onto paper, and Google indexed the web. What’s new is the degree of autonomy granted to AI. Instead of rehearsing multiplication or drafting an outline, the learner now supervises a machine that does the heavy lifting. This shift moves students from active problem-solvers to passive overseers, offering far fewer repetitions for strengthening judgment.

How Over-Offloading Shapes Developing Minds

Critical thinking and problem-solving slide

Across studies published in 2024-25 one pattern recurs: frequent AI reliance predicts weaker independent reasoning. Analysis has shown a strong negative correlation between the ability to reason and AI use, even after controlling for socioeconomic factors. Pupils using AI increasingly skip outlining arguments or researching because ‘the bot can handle it’.

This passivity undermines the intellectual resilience children will need to deal with situations when life offers no ready-made prompt.

Memory retention takes a hit

Memory thrives on struggle. Experiments on AI usage’s impact on retention asked adolescents to master biology terms: half built their own flashcards, half relied on AI-generated ones. A week later, the self-generated group recalled 22% more material, leading researchers to conclude that delegating memory exercises to a chatbot removed the ‘desirable difficulty’ that cements long-term memories.

Creativity narrows rather than blooms

Generative tools can certainly spark ideas, yet they also steer them. University of Washington researchers spent six weeks observing children aged seven to thirteen as they wrote stories and designed characters. The youngest participants latched onto the first suggestions provided by ChatGPT or DALL-E, producing work that was slick yet derivative.

A University of South Carolina study found a similar pattern: every student valued AI for brainstorming, but only one in six preferred to ideate without it, hinting at an emerging dependence that may dull divergent thinking.

Younger users are uniquely vulnerable

Executive functions that govern self-regulation mature well into the mid-twenties, making children especially susceptible to the path of least resistance. Surveys have recorded that teens with the highest AI-dependence scores had the lowest critical-thinking performance. Younger pupils often overestimate both their own skill and the bot’s accuracy, gravitating toward offloading even when unnecessary.

The multiplier of bias and misinformation

Accepting AI text uncritically imports its errors. Generative systems can ‘launder’ training-set biases into authoritative-sounding outputs, which children might not question if they’re yet to master the media-literacy safeguards needed to question what the AI is telling them.

With millions drawing on the same large language models, a subtle homogenisation of thought is already detectable, narrowing the intellectual diversity that fuels real innovation.

Teaching Healthy AI Habits Without Stifling Innovation

As far as we can tell, AI is going to be a major part of our children’s futures. Practically every industry is increasing its use of generative AI, which means they’ll need to be taught how to use AI to succeed in the future. But we can help tackle the problems of cognitive offloading among children from AI use with the right approaches.

Cultivate AI literacy early

The best antidote to blind trust is transparent understanding. Learning how advanced AI systems such as the Claude Sonnet model generate responses can help students develop a deeper understanding of the technology they increasingly encounter in education and everyday life. Children need to be taught early on that ‘AI sometimes guesses’, before scaling this healthy skepticism up as they get older to examinations of AI bias, ethics, and prompt engineering.

Fact-checking routines, such as cross-referencing a chatbot’s claim with reputable sources, need to be taught, and just short sessions can dramatically sharpen verification skills within weeks.

Encourage productive struggle before assistance

Research on memory shows learning improves when the effort precedes any help, particularly from AI. Teachers can formalise this with ‘AI-free first drafts,’ brainstorming on paper or timed problem-solving sprints.

Only after students have articulated their own approach can the bot act as a sparring partner, suggesting alternatives to compare. Data indicates that retention rebounds when the human step comes first, and pupils themselves report greater confidence in their reasoning.

Design assignments that reward reflection

Instead of banning AI, reframe tasks so that the value lies in the student’s thinking. A history project might require an appendix explaining how the writer evaluated the chatbot’s suggestions, where they diverged, and why. In the University of Washington’s creativity study, children who had to justify each AI-assisted decision became more selective and produced richer revisions than their peers who simply accepted the first output.

Keep the human in the loop

Learning is social. Group debates, maker projects, and outdoor experiments cultivate skills no chatbot can replicate.

Build equitable, transparent systems

Children should know who trains the model and why. Open-source tools or plain-language explainers empower them to question an AI’s output, a cornerstone of critical thinking.

Ensuring universal access also prevents a two-tier landscape where only affluent schools learn to direct AI while others merely consume it. Equitable, transparent design choices align the technology with education’s core mission: nurturing independent, well-informed thinkers.

Conclusion

Artificial intelligence is a paradox: a powerful amplifier of human intellect that can also sap the very capacities it augments. Shielding children from it is neither realistic nor desirable yet giving them uncritical access is equally risky.

We need to weave AI literacy, productive struggle, and reflective practice into schooling, so parents and teachers can keep critical thought, memory, and creativity at the heart of learning. If we succeed, tomorrow’s adults will treat AI not as a crutch but as a catalyst, leveraging its speed while keeping ownership of the deep, uniquely human thinking that makes knowledge worth having.
